**Ticket: Config drift on BounceSift processor**

The email bounce processor in the Larkfield environment has drifted from the values committed in the release branch. Retry windows and suppression thresholds no longer match, which likely explains the duplicate suppression entries reported Tuesday. Please reconcile before the Thursday cut. For reference, the currently deployed configuration on the live node reads as follows.

config for yajep-yahof:
[briax]
port = 9200
region = outer-2
host = briax.nelvrocorp.test
team = raleth
timeout_ms = 1500
retries = 1

**Vendor note: Inkmill markdown pipeline**

Rendering for Parchway docs is outsourced to Inkmill under an annual contract, renewing each March. They handle sanitization and PDF export; we own the upload queue. SLA: 4-hour response on rendering failures. Escalate only after two failed retries. Their support desk is reachable at the address below.

billing contact of hahaf-baguf = zorael.tammir.jorius@sivrelhq.internal

Handover — Holiday Opening Hours (Facilities Desk)

Hi Merrow, during the Larchview closure week the main doors lock at 16:00 sharp, not 18:30. Security rounds move to hourly, and deliveries go to the side entrance only. Please update the lobby signage on Monday. For after-hours desk access during the closure, use the code below.

door code, yagap-bahof: bdg-O-05

Title: Audio stops at gallery transitions in Wrenhall Guide

Steps: start any tour in the Tidemark Museum app, walk between zones, playback cuts out and won't resume without force-quit. Affects roughly a third of testers. Suspect the beacon handoff logic. Repro confirmed on the build listed below.

pipeline stamp: htk31_f769b577b3028a4e9958e5bb8d1259a

Ticket: Staging env misconfigured for Siftgate bloom filter

The bloom layer in front of the Pellet KV store is rejecting all lookups in staging because the env file was copied from the dev template without credentials. False-positive tuning values are fine; only the auth line is missing. To unblock the weekly demo, the Pellet admission secret must be set on the following line.

env line for yaguf-fajop: LEDGER_TOKEN13=fb08984397349